The Godfather and Beyond: Building a Cinematic Empire
Early Successes and Box Office Gold
Francis Ford Coppola's rise to prominence began with his groundbreaking work in the 1970s. The Godfather, released in 1972, was a monumental success, both critically and commercially. This cinematic masterpiece not only solidified Coppola's reputation as a visionary director but also generated substantial revenue, laying the foundation for his future ventures. The film's unprecedented success allowed Coppola to reinvest in his own projects, giving him greater creative control and financial independence. The Godfather became a cultural phenomenon, and its impact on cinema is still felt today. Its success was not just a fluke, but a testament to Coppola's storytelling ability and his meticulous attention to detail. This early triumph was a crucial stepping stone in his journey to building a diversified and influential empire.

American Zoetrope: A Creative Hub
Founded in 1969, American Zoetrope is Francis Ford Coppola's production company. This venture has been instrumental in supporting independent filmmaking and fostering new talent. While not always a consistent profit-generator, Zoetrope has been a vital component of Coppola's artistic endeavors, allowing him to take risks and experiment with unconventional projects. Zoetrope has served as a launchpad for many successful careers, providing a platform for emerging filmmakers to showcase their work. Coppola's commitment to nurturing talent has not only enriched the film industry but has also solidified his legacy as a mentor and innovator. The production company has faced its share of challenges, but Coppola's unwavering dedication has kept it alive and thriving. It stands as a testament to his belief in the power of independent cinema and his willingness to support artists who share his vision.

Cafe Zoetrope and Culinary Ventures
Adding another layer to his diverse empire, Coppola owns Cafe Zoetrope in San Francisco. This restaurant serves as a hub for artists and cinephiles, blending his love for film with his passion for food and hospitality. The cafe is known for its Italian cuisine and its vibrant atmosphere, attracting a diverse clientele of locals and tourists alike. This culinary venture is a reflection of Coppola's personal tastes and his desire to create a space that celebrates creativity and community. Cafe Zoetrope is more than just a restaurant; it's a gathering place for people who share his love for film, food, and conversation.
